Quality Management Principles
In today’s competitive landscape, delivering consistent value is non-negotiable. Quality management is the systematic approach to ensuring that an organization’s products and services reliably meet or exceed customer expectations. It transforms quality from a final inspection checkpoint into a core strategic discipline, driving efficiency, building reputation, and fostering sustainable growth by relentlessly focusing on processes and people.
Foundational Principles: Customer Focus and Leadership
At its heart, quality management begins with a customer-focused orientation. This means understanding both stated and unstated customer needs and using that understanding to drive all organizational processes. Quality is ultimately defined by the customer, not internal standards. Achieving this focus requires committed leadership. Leaders must establish a unity of purpose, create an environment where people are engaged, and set clear quality objectives that align with the strategic direction. Without active, visible leadership from the top, quality initiatives become isolated departmental projects rather than a core business philosophy.
This leadership was championed by W. Edwards Deming, whose Deming's principles, often framed as his 14 Points for Management, provide a foundational philosophy. Key among these are: driving out fear to enable open reporting of problems, ceasing dependence on mass inspection (building quality in instead), instituting vigorous education and retraining, and breaking down barriers between departments. Deming’s System of Profound Knowledge emphasizes understanding systems, accounting for variation, building knowledge, and understanding psychology. His famous Plan-Do-Study-Act (PDSA) cycle is the engine of continuous improvement, or Kaizen, a core tenet stating that processes can always be made more efficient, effective, and adaptable.
The Framework: Quality Assurance, Control, and Standards
While principles guide philosophy, organizations need structured frameworks. This is where quality assurance (QA) and quality control (QC) operate. Quality control is the operational techniques and activities used to fulfill quality requirements. It is product-oriented and reactive, involving the inspection and testing of outputs to identify defects—for example, measuring the dimensions of a machined part against a specification. Quality assurance, in contrast, is process-oriented and proactive. It encompasses all the planned and systematic activities implemented within the quality system to provide confidence that a product or service will satisfy given requirements. QA is about preventing defects by ensuring processes are designed correctly and consistently followed.
A globally recognized framework for QA is the ISO standards, particularly the ISO 9001 standard for Quality Management Systems. ISO 9001 provides a set of standardized requirements for a QMS, regardless of an organization’s size or industry. It is based on seven core principles: customer focus, leadership, engagement of people, process approach, improvement, evidence-based decision making, and relationship management. Certification to ISO 9001 signals to customers that the organization has a systematic approach to managing processes that affect quality. Implementing such a standard moves quality from an abstract goal to an auditable, integrated business system.

The Integrated System: Total Quality Management
Bringing all these elements together forms Total Quality Management (TQM). TQM is a comprehensive, organization-wide effort to embed awareness of quality in all organizational processes. It is not a specific tool but a management system that integrates fundamental concepts, continuous improvement techniques, and quantitative tools in a culture focused on customer satisfaction. TQM involves all employees in cross-functional teams to solve problems, employs statistical methods for process control, and requires a long-term commitment to training and cultural change. The goal is to create a chain reaction Deming described: improved quality leads to decreased costs (less rework, fewer delays, better use of resources), which leads to improved productivity, allowing a company to capture the market and provide jobs.
Common Pitfalls
- Confusing Certification with a Culture of Quality: Many organizations pursue ISO standards certification solely for marketing purposes, treating it as a paperwork exercise. The pitfall is creating a system that exists only for the auditor. The correction is to leverage the ISO framework to genuinely improve processes, engage employees, and drive value, using the audit as a health check rather than an exam to cram for.
- Over-Reliance on Final Inspection (QC over QA): Focusing predominantly on quality control—finding bad products at the end of the line—is expensive and ineffective. It treats symptoms, not causes. The correction is to invest in quality assurance, shifting resources upstream to design robust processes and mistake-proofing (poka-yoke) to prevent defects from occurring in the first place.
- Launching Isolated "Quality Programs": Treating TQM or Six Sigma as a temporary initiative with a start and end date guarantees failure. When the program ends, old habits return. The correction is to integrate quality principles into the very fabric of the organization’s strategy, leadership behaviors, performance metrics, and reward systems, making it "the way we work."
- Ignoring the Voice of the Customer: Defining quality solely by internal engineering specifications is a critical error. A product can be perfectly built to the wrong specifications. The correction is to implement systematic methods (surveys, focus groups, user analytics) to capture both the stated and latent needs of the customer and regularly validate that processes are aligned to meet them.
Summary
- Quality management is a strategic, systematic approach encompassing philosophy (customer focus, leadership), frameworks (ISO 9001), and tools (statistical process control, PDSA) to ensure consistent excellence.
- Distinguish between Quality Control (QC)—inspecting outputs for defects—and Quality Assurance (QA)—designing processes to prevent defects. A mature system emphasizes QA.
- Core principles, derived from thought leaders like Deming, emphasize continuous improvement, breaking down silos, driving out fear, and making decisions based on data, not opinion.
